Abstract
In this chapter, we introduce the DMC8 microprocessor through the study of a microcomputer based on it. In particular we will present the organization of its bus, its architecture, and how it carries out instructions. Then we will start to detail the behavior over time of the processor’s bus signals. Consequently we will present how memory and input/output subsystems can be organized and designed. Finally we will show how the Deeds simulator supports the development of projects based on the DMC8 microprocessor, including writing programs and functionally testing them.
